What is a Low Profile Window Air Conditioner?
A low profile window air conditioner is a compact cooling unit designed to fit in standard window frames while maintaining a slim aesthetic. These units are particularly beneficial for homes or apartments with limited window space, as they protrude less than traditional window air conditioning units, making them less obtrusive and easier to install.
According to the U.S. Department of Energy, window air conditioners are a popular choice for cooling smaller spaces, and low profile models are especially sought after for their space-saving design and energy efficiency.
Key aspects of low profile window air conditioners include their reduced height and width, allowing them to fit into shorter windows or tighter spaces without sacrificing cooling power. Many models come equipped with features such as remote control operation, programmable timers, and energy-saving settings, enhancing their usability and efficiency. Additionally, they often utilize advanced technology to minimize noise levels, making them suitable for bedrooms or quiet environments.
The impact of low profile window air conditioners is significant, particularly in urban settings where living spaces are often compact. They provide an effective cooling solution without compromising window views or natural light. Their design allows for easier installation and removal, making them a practical choice for renters or those who frequently need to relocate their cooling units. According to a report by the Air Conditioning, Heating, and Refrigeration Institute, the demand for energy-efficient air conditioning solutions, including low profile models, has increased by over 30% in the past five years.
Benefits of low profile window air conditioners include improved aesthetics, as they blend more seamlessly with the window structure, and enhanced mobility, allowing users to easily transfer them between rooms or residences. Additionally, their energy efficiency can lead to lower utility bills, which is a crucial consideration for environmentally conscious consumers. For optimal performance, it’s essential to choose a model that matches the room size and to regularly maintain the unit by cleaning filters and checking seals to ensure maximum efficiency.
Best practices for selecting a low profile window air conditioner involve assessing the cooling capacity based on the room size, looking for ENERGY STAR certified units, and considering additional features such as programmable thermostats or smart home compatibility. Furthermore, proper installation is key to ensuring that the air conditioner operates effectively and efficiently, so following manufacturer guidelines or hiring a professional installer can greatly enhance the unit’s performance.
What Key Features Should You Look for in a Low Profile Window Air Conditioner?
When searching for the best low profile window air conditioner, consider the following key features:
- Compact Design: A low profile air conditioner should have a sleek, compact design that fits snugly in the window without obstructing the view. This is especially important for small spaces where aesthetics and functionality must be balanced.
- Energy Efficiency: Look for models with high Energy Efficiency Ratio (EER) ratings, as these units consume less electricity while providing adequate cooling. Energy-efficient models not only reduce your carbon footprint but also help lower electricity bills.
- Quiet Operation: A low profile window air conditioner should operate quietly, allowing for a comfortable indoor environment without disruptive noise. Many modern units come with noise-reduction technology that enhances user comfort during operation.
- Cooling Capacity: The cooling capacity, measured in BTUs (British Thermal Units), should match the size of the room to ensure effective cooling. A unit that is too small will struggle to cool the space, while one that is too large may cool too quickly without removing humidity.
- Multiple Fan Speeds and Modes: Having various fan speeds and cooling modes allows users to customize their comfort levels based on personal preference and room conditions. Options such as energy saver mode and sleep mode can enhance efficiency and comfort during the night.
- Easy Installation: The best low profile window air conditioners come with straightforward installation instructions and all necessary hardware. Some models may even feature a window mounting kit to simplify the setup process.
- Remote Control and Smart Features: Many modern air conditioners include remote controls, allowing users to adjust settings from a distance. Additionally, smart features such as Wi-Fi connectivity enable control via smartphone apps, enhancing convenience and usability.
- Filter Maintenance Alerts: A good air conditioner should have a filter indicator that alerts you when it’s time to clean or replace the filter. Regular maintenance is essential for optimal performance and air quality.
How Does Energy Efficiency Affect the Performance of Low Profile Window Air Conditioners?
Energy efficiency plays a crucial role in the performance of low profile window air conditioners, impacting both their operational effectiveness and cost savings.
- Energy Efficiency Ratio (EER): The EER measures the cooling output of an air conditioner divided by its energy consumption in watts. A higher EER indicates better energy efficiency, meaning the unit will provide more cooling for each watt of electricity consumed, which is particularly important for low profile models that often operate in compact spaces.
- Seasonal Energy Efficiency Ratio (SEER): SEER is a more comprehensive measure that considers the cooling output over an entire season against the total energy consumed. Low profile window air conditioners with a higher SEER rating tend to operate more efficiently, leading to lower electricity bills and reduced environmental impact over time.
- Inverter Technology: Units equipped with inverter technology can adjust their cooling output based on the ambient temperature, leading to more efficient operation. This means that low profile window air conditioners can maintain a consistent temperature without excessive energy use, enhancing their overall performance.
- Size and Capacity: The size and cooling capacity of the air conditioner significantly affect its efficiency. An appropriately sized low profile window air conditioner will cool a room more effectively than a unit that is too large or too small, thus optimizing energy consumption and improving performance.
- Insulation and Sealing: Proper insulation and sealing around the window where the air conditioner is installed can greatly enhance energy efficiency. Low profile units that are well-sealed reduce air leakage, allowing them to maintain desired temperatures without working harder, which in turn boosts their performance and longevity.
- Smart Features: Many modern low profile window air conditioners include smart features such as programmable timers and remote controls. These features allow users to optimize usage patterns and adjust settings based on occupancy, leading to improved energy efficiency and performance.
- Filter Maintenance: Regular maintenance of air filters ensures optimal airflow and efficiency. A clean filter in a low profile window air conditioner not only improves air quality but also allows the unit to operate more efficiently, thereby enhancing its cooling performance and extending its lifespan.
What Are the Noise Levels Typically Associated with Low Profile Window Air Conditioners?
When considering low profile window air conditioners, noise levels can significantly impact comfort and usability. Typically, these units operate within a range of 50 to 60 decibels (dB), which is comparable to a quiet conversation or background music.
Factors influencing noise levels include:
- Design and Build Quality: Units with better insulation and vibration dampening technology tend to operate more quietly.
- Fan Speed Settings: Many low profile models offer multiple fan speeds. Higher settings may generate more noise, while lower ones can be quieter.
- Compressor Type: Inverter compressors adjust their speed based on cooling demand, resulting in less noise compared to traditional fixed-speed compressors.
- Location and Installation: Proper installation can minimize vibrations and rattling, enhancing overall quietness.
To find a low profile air conditioner that suits your noise preference, consider models that specify low noise operation and read user reviews that mention sound levels. Brands often provide this information in their product specifications, making it easier to choose a quieter model suitable for bedrooms or other noise-sensitive environments.

How Should You Install a Low Profile Window Air Conditioner?
Installing a low profile window air conditioner requires careful planning and execution for optimal performance.
- Choose the Right Size: Selecting the appropriate size for your window AC unit ensures efficient cooling and energy use.
- Gather Necessary Tools: Preparation involves having the right tools to facilitate a smooth installation process.
- Prepare the Window Frame: Properly preparing the window frame helps in securing the air conditioner effectively.
- Install the Mounting Bracket: The mounting bracket provides stability and support for the air conditioner during operation.
- Insert the Air Conditioner: Carefully placing the unit into the window ensures it is positioned correctly for optimal performance.
- Seal and Insulate: Sealing gaps and adding insulation prevents air leaks, improving efficiency and comfort.
- Test the Unit: Testing the air conditioner after installation ensures it operates correctly and meets cooling needs.
Choosing the right size for your low profile window air conditioner is crucial as it directly impacts cooling efficiency and energy consumption. An undersized unit will struggle to cool the space, while an oversized unit may cycle on and off too frequently, wasting energy.
Gathering necessary tools such as a level, screwdriver, and measuring tape will make the installation process easier and more efficient. Having everything on hand before starting can save time and reduce frustration during setup.
Preparing the window frame involves cleaning the area and checking for any obstructions that could interfere with the installation. It’s important to ensure that the window can support the weight of the air conditioner and is free from debris.
Installing the mounting bracket securely is essential to provide the air conditioner with the needed support. This bracket should be attached according to the manufacturer’s instructions to guarantee stability during use.
When inserting the air conditioner, ensure it is tilted slightly toward the outside to allow for proper drainage of condensation. This positioning also helps the unit operate more effectively in cooling the room.
Sealing around the unit with weather stripping or foam insulation will help eliminate any gaps that could let in hot air or allow cool air to escape. This step enhances the unit’s efficiency and can lead to lower energy bills.
Finally, testing the unit after installation is important to confirm that it is functioning as intended. Check for proper cooling, listen for unusual sounds, and monitor the airflow to ensure everything is operating smoothly.
What Maintenance Tips Can Help Extend the Lifespan of Your Low Profile Window Air Conditioner?
To extend the lifespan of your low profile window air conditioner, consider the following maintenance tips:
- Regular Cleaning of Filters: Clean or replace the air filters every month or two, especially during peak usage seasons.
- Inspect and Clean the Coils: Ensure that the evaporator and condenser coils are clean and free of debris to maintain efficiency.
- Check for Leaks: Regularly inspect the unit for refrigerant leaks and ensure that any problems are addressed promptly.
- Ensure Proper Drainage: Make sure the drainage holes are clear to prevent water buildup, which can lead to mold and damage.
- Seasonal Maintenance: Prepare your air conditioner for the off-season by covering it and performing a thorough check before it’s used again.
Regular cleaning of filters is essential, as dirty filters can restrict airflow, making the air conditioner work harder and reducing its efficiency and lifespan. It is recommended to check filters monthly during heavy use and clean or replace them as needed to ensure optimal performance.
Inspecting and cleaning the coils is crucial because dirt buildup on the coils can significantly hinder their ability to absorb heat, causing the unit to overheat and wear out faster. Keeping the coils clean helps maintain the unit’s cooling efficiency and prolongs its operational life.
Checking for leaks is important as refrigerant leaks can not only reduce cooling efficiency but also lead to more severe damage if not addressed. If you suspect a leak, it is advisable to consult a professional to handle the repair, ensuring the air conditioner operates safely and effectively.
Ensuring proper drainage is vital to prevent water from accumulating in the unit, which can lead to rust, corrosion, and mold growth. Regularly checking the drainage holes and cleaning them as necessary can help avoid these issues and maintain air quality.
Seasonal maintenance involves preparing the air conditioner for periods of non-use by covering it and conducting a thorough check to ensure all components are in working order before the next cooling season begins. This proactive approach helps to identify potential issues early and keeps the unit in good condition for future use.
